T = tan, P/B = pink with black tracer, W-OR/PPL TR = white/orange/purple tracer (there's only one wire that color, and it's the one with woven cloth insulation from the bulkhead connector to the (+) terminal on the coil - it's a special resistance wire).
The number on each wire is the wire gauge (bigger number, smaller wire and vice versa); somewhere there's a conversion table from American wire gauge to metric wire size, but I don't have it.
